Batteries for the 2005 Daihatsu Bego: What You Need to Know

The 2005 Daihatsu Bego, a compact SUV known for its practicality and reliability, does indeed use a battery as a vital component of its electrical system. Like most internal combustion engine vehicles, the battery in the Bego plays an essential role in starting the engine and powering electrical accessories. Without a battery, the 2005 Bego would not be able to fire up, let alone operate the vehicle's lights, radio, or other electronic features.

The battery in the 2005 Daihatsu Bego is typically a 12-volt lead-acid battery, just like most cars of its class and era. Its primary job is to provide the necessary electrical power to crank the engine. When you turn the ignition key, the battery delivers a surge of electricity to the starter motor, which then gets the petrol engine running. Once the engine is alive, the alternator takes over and supplies power to the vehicle's electrical systems while simultaneously charging the battery.

Besides starting the car, the battery also acts as a stabiliser for the electrical system. It ensures the vehicle's voltage doesn't fluctuate too wildly, which helps protect sensitive components and keeps everything running smoothly. This means if you use the headlights, turn signals, or dashboard instruments, the battery helps keep those systems powered at a consistent level. It's not just about being able to start the car, the battery supports the vehicle's entire electrical environment.

When it comes to battery maintenance for the 2005 Daihatsu Bego, there are some practical points to keep in mind to avoid those annoying moments when the vehicle won't start. First off, regular checks under the bonnet are a good habit. Look out for corrosion at the battery terminals, which can appear as a white or bluish powder. This build-up can disrupt the electrical connection and reduce battery performance. Cleaning the terminals with a simple mix of baking soda and water or a dedicated battery terminal cleaner can keep things running smoothly.

Battery fluid levels can also be important, especially if the battery is the older type that has removable caps. Maintaining the right fluid level ensures the lead plates inside the battery stay submerged and functional. Low fluid levels could shorten the battery's life and reduce its ability to hold charge. However, many modern batteries are sealed and maintenance-free, so it's best to check the specifications that apply to the battery fitted in the 2005 Bego.

Regular testing of the battery's charge and health is another smart move. Mechanics often use a voltmeter or dedicated battery tester during routine servicing to check if the battery can still hold a good charge. A fully charged 12-volt battery should read around 12.6 volts or higher when the engine is off. Anything significantly lower might mean the battery is struggling and may need replacing soon.

For those in Australia or similar climates, it's worth noting that extreme heat can take its toll on car batteries. The engine bay of the Bego can get quite hot in summer, which may speed up the breakdown of battery components over time. If the vehicle is often exposed to extreme weather, it might be wise to have the battery checked more frequently or consider a battery with a higher heat tolerance rating.

When it comes time to replace the battery on the 2005 Daihatsu Bego, it's important to choose one that matches the vehicle's specifications. This means matching the size, voltage, and cold cranking amps (CCA). The CCA is especially important if you live in a colder part of Australia or plan to take the vehicle on trips where starting reliability is crucial. Higher CCA ratings mean the battery can deliver more power at cold temperatures, which reduces the chance of a flat battery starting frustration.

Replacement batteries can be purchased at most automotive parts stores or directly through dealerships. When swapping out the battery, it's best practice to ensure all electrical systems are turned off to avoid any voltage spikes that could damage the vehicle's electronics. After installation, a quick check to make sure the vehicle starts properly and that no warning lights remain on the dashboard will give peace of mind.

In terms of battery lifespan, a typical car battery can last anywhere from three to five years, depending on usage, climate, and maintenance habits. Keeping the battery terminals clean, avoiding short trips that do not allow the alternator to fully recharge the battery, and parking in shaded or cool areas when possible can all help extend the battery's life. If the vehicle is left unused for long periods, it might be worth disconnecting the battery or using a battery maintainer to keep it charged.
